ENGG 191 - Remote Sensing

Semester Hours: 3
Spring
Properties of waves, their propagation and reflection. Directional features of antennas and relationship to spatial resolution. Radar (active) sensing for target detection and Doppler measurement with application to aircraft observation, traffic radar techniques, and rain measurement. The Global Positioning System, its principles and uses. Thermal emission of radiation, including the passive sensing of temperature, materials, and surfaces, from microwave to infrared frequencies. Earth observation and monitoring from space.  RFID (Radio Frequency Identification) technologies, data types, and applications. Acoustic waves in fluids, ultrasonic propagation and applications.  

Prerequisite(s)/Course Notes:
ENGG 111  and 177  or permission of instructor. May not be taken on a Pass/D+/D/Fail basis.
